Output 89a62784fb8bfdb675b7cad0ab0a52540646528fb4db4deb870e433cfbf0c3f3:4

value
12484293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febddde86204d88d767ab4fa96012098301871 OP_EQUAL
address
MPfsdBmB19cfhp1J1dwb8K7musKY4iEJuY
transaction
89a62784fb8bfdb675b7cad0ab0a52540646528fb4db4deb870e433cfbf0c3f3
spent
true